Selecting Ideal Aquatic Plants
When establishing a water garden, selecting suitable aquatic plants is essential for creating a harmonious and visually appealing ecosystem. The selection of plants should factor in the specific conditions of the pond, such as sunlight, water depth, and climate. Edge plants, like cattails and rushes, enrich the shoreline, while floating plants, like water lilies and lotus, offer shade and reduce algae growth. Submerged plants, like anacharis and hornwort, oxygenate the water and supply habitat for aquatic life. It is vital to pick native species, as they adapt well to local environments and support regional wildlife. A varied selection of plants not only improves the pond but also contributes to its overall health and stability.

Best Fish Species
Selecting the right fish species for a water garden can considerably enhance both its visual attractiveness and ecological balance. Common selections include koi, goldfish, and native minnows, each adding distinctive colors and movements to the pond. Koi are famous for their vibrant patterns and can grow quite large, making them a focal point. Goldfish, found in diverse colors and sizes, offer a lively presence and are hardy in diverse conditions. Native minnows help maintain a balanced ecosystem, as they help control mosquito populations and provide food for larger fish. Moreover, aquatic plants can be incorporated to provide shelter for smaller fish and enhance the overall beauty of the water garden, creating a harmonious aquatic environment.

Your Pond's Health and Water Quality Connection
Water quality plays an essential role in determining the overall health of a pond, as it directly affects the balance of aquatic life within. Parameters such as pH, dissolved oxygen, and nutrient levels play a major role in ecosystem stability. A balanced pH typically ranges from 6.5 to 8.5, enabling fish and plant life to thrive. Low dissolved oxygen levels can lead to fish stress or even mortality, while excessive nutrients often lead to algal blooms that deplete oxygen and block sunlight. Monitoring these factors is crucial; poor water quality can disrupt the food chain and lead to imbalances, affecting both flora and fauna. Regular testing and appropriate management strategies, such as aeration and filtration, can minimize these risks. By ensuring optimal water conditions, pond owners can foster a vibrant ecosystem, supporting healthy fish populations and diverse plant life essential for a thriving water garden.
